Robot mode, not much to say, he's awesome looking, fully articulated, cool light-piping, great poseability... nothing bad to say about it
For some reason I like to raise the jet in-takes, it gives him a Seeker look... hehe
My only problem in robot mode is... what to do with the big foot? In jet mode the foot acts like a stand to pose de jet... but in robot? Well I kind of use it as a big-ass claw thing:
Jet mode: the top it looks Superb! REALLY nice jet!
But for some reason, just like his predecessor, I kind of feel that from underneath he somewhat suffers from a Robot stuck underneath a jet

Now here's the fun part, They do fit onto
TFC Hercules
For some reason, the Arm didnt connect onto the Rage of Hercules shoulder adapter (seen in the video review) but fits perfectly onto the original peg on
TFC Hercs.
TFC Uranos F-15 Eagle AirRaid is a tiny bit bigger than
TFC Hercs original legs, so I'm convinced
TFC Uranos will be a bit taller than
TFC Hercs.
Yes he's worth it. I believe he's a better toy than its predecessor, the transformation is a tiny bit intricate which I like. If not for the figure itself, the combined
TFC Uranos will be worth it. Get it!
